The San Antonio Spurs superstar Victor Wembanyama recently gave a powerful speech after being named the captain of the France team.
Victor Wembanyama will be in France for the FIBA Basketball World Cup 2027 European Qualifiers. Though already an NBA superstar, the San Antonio Spurs’ talented center was recently named the captain of the national team.
He was handed the responsibility by the French coach, along with much-needed praise for his work ethic. Wemby delivered his speech to a relatively older squad, even though he is the youngest among them.
“Do you want me to do a speech? Oh yeah? Well, honestly it’s a real honor. I know I’m the youngest here but I fully intend to lead by example. I know you guys are counting on me to get buckets, to get stops, but I also intend to do my best to carry the team. And it’s with great pleasure and a huge honor that I take on this responsibility. Thanks,” he said with a smile on his face.
Coach: “We’ve decided that Victor will be our new captain. For his exemplary attitude, for his work ethic, and for the future, for everything that awaits us. So welcome and congratulations Victor.”

The nod comes after the two-time NBA All-Star wrapped up one of his best seasons with the Spurs. Wemby led the team to the NBA Finals but could not outlast the New York Knicks, who took home the championship trophy after a 53 year drought.
During his postseason run, he averaged 23.8 points, 10.9 rebounds, and 3.5 blocks. Additionally, he won the Western Conference Finals MVP award, thanks in large part to his dominant 40-point performance against the Oklahoma City Thunder.
While a championship ring looked almost promised, the last stretch of the tournament cost Wembanyama and the Spurs the Finals series. Now with the 2026-27 season coming ahead, the Frenchman will have a good stretch of basketball action for his national team.
